如何在 Codex 中使用 GLM 4.5:實用指南

如何在 Codex 中使用 GLM 4.5:實用指南

GLM 4.5 是 Z.ai 推出的旗艦大型語言模型,在推理、編程與代理任務上表現優異。透過 Mixture-of-Experts(混合專家)架構與擴展上下文處理等先進優化技術,它為需要強大效能與高效開發流程的開發者樹立了全新標竿。

與此同時,Codex 是一款輕量但功能強大的命令列介面(CLI),能讓大型語言模型的使用更快速、更靈活。你不需要綁定在 IDE 中,可以直接在終端機執行提示詞、測試程式碼,並連接多個 API 供應商。

本指南將教你如何在 Codex 中使用 GLM 4.5,從安裝、配置到執行第一個編程任務,讓你能快速將強大的模型能力轉化為流暢的開發工作流程。

GLM 4.5 基礎知識與亮點

基本功能

功能 詳細資訊
參數量 總計 355B,啟動參數量 32B
架構 混合專家(Mixture-of-Experts)
上下文視窗 128K tokens
推理模式 思考 + 非思考
多模態 僅文字
多語言能力 支援多種語言,英文與中文表現優異

GLM 4.5 Benchmark

GLM 4.5 基準測試結果

核心亮點

架構與訓練

  • 深化混合專家架構 – 更多層、更窄的寬度設計,在保持效率的同時提升推理深度。
  • 超大規模預訓練語料庫 – 15 萬億 tokens 的訓練數據,覆蓋廣泛知識領域。
  • 先進強化學習基礎設施 – 開源平台,支援可擴展的強化學習與代理訓練。
  • 技能整合 – 將強化學習與監督學習提煉為穩健的專家模型。

代理能力

  • 專為自主代理設計,原生支援函數調用、上下文內網頁瀏覽多步驟任務規劃
  • 無需繁重的外部編排即可運行工具鏈,對代理框架的適配性更靈活。

編程優勢

  • 擅長端到端軟體開發,從前端、後端到資料庫處理都能勝任。
  • 程式碼生成與除錯能力強,同時支援 CLI 環境下的終端級操作
  • 算法設計與實際工程任務上表現穩健,經由領先模型基準測試驗證。

推理能力

  • 數學推理(AIME、MATH 基準測試)表現優異,成績位居前列。
  • 科學與邏輯問題解決能力強,支援多步驟推理。
  • 長上下文理解能力出色,在超長輸入下仍能保持高準確率。

為何要在 Codex 中使用 GLM 4.5

GLM 4.5 本身表現就已非常出色,但與 Codex 結合後,能更高效地將其優勢融入日常開發。Codex 不是普通的介面,而是一款命令列編程代理,專為讓大型語言模型在終端機中自然使用而設計,而終端機正是多數開發者最常使用的工具。

Codex 作為開發者的好幫手

與 IDE 外掛或瀏覽器儀表板不同,Codex 輕量且原生適配終端機。這意味著你可以直接調用 GLM 4.5、測試輸出結果、管理多個 API,無需切換工具。對於重視速度與掌控感的開發者來說,這種命令列方案無可替代。

在 Codex 中使用 GLM 4.5 的核心優勢

優勢 對開發者的意義
直接存取模型 無需離開終端機,執行提示詞即可即時獲得結果。
自動化工作流程 可在單一流程中編排「生成 → 測試 → 提交」這類任務。
靈活整合 只需極少配置即可輕鬆切換不同供應商。
輕量部署 無需繁重的 IDE 整合,僅需簡單的命令列工具即可使用。

相較 Codex 原生模型,使用 GLM 4.5 的優勢

Codex 原生模型非常適合大範圍的編程任務與通用開發,但 GLM-4.5 具備獨特優勢,能在特定場景中作為有價值的補充:

  • 專業編程支援:GLM-4.5 專為混合推理與編程場景設計,在結構化程式碼生成、迭代式除錯與工具使用工作流程上的表現更一致,非常適合構建代理管線的開發者。
  • 代理友好能力:原生支援函數調用、工具使用與任務規劃模式,GLM-4.5 能自然適配代理工作流程,讓開發者更容易試驗自主代理,或將多步驟推理整合到生產系統中。

整體而言,Codex 提供強大的通用編程能力,而 GLM-4.5 則非常適合開發流程中的專業推理與代理整合需求。

實際應用場景

  • 原型開發:幾秒內即可起草 Python 腳本並立即執行。
  • 除錯:快速迭代測試 SQL 查詢或程式碼片段。
  • 企業工作流程:在重視可審計性的合規環境中運行。

簡而言之,Codex 讓 GLM 4.5 不僅是一個強大的模型,更是日常編程、推理與代理工作流程的實用工具。

如何在 Codex 中使用 GLM 4.5:前置需求概述

要在 Codex 中使用 GLM 4.5,你需要準備好三樣東西:

  1. GLM 4.5 的 API 金鑰:建議從 Novita AI 獲取,並存儲在配置文件中以實現無縫整合。
  2. Codex CLI:全域安裝,讓你可以直接在終端機調用代理。
  3. 可用的運行環境:Node.js 18 或更高版本,以及用於套件管理的 npm。

準備好這些後,你就有足夠的條件連接 Codex 與 GLM 4.5 並開始試驗。整個配置非常輕量,全程僅需幾分鐘。

如何在 Codex 中使用 GLM 4.5:逐步指南

步驟 1:在 Novita AI 獲取 API 金鑰

首先前往 Novita AI 官網 建立帳號,接著在平台中生成 API 金鑰,然後進入 金鑰管理頁面,選擇「新增金鑰」。

這個 API 金鑰是你的存取憑證,由於它只會顯示一次,請立即複製並妥善保存,後續步驟會用到它。

Novita AI 為多款最先進的模型提供一流的 Codex 支援,例如:

  • zai-org/glm-4.5
  • deepseek/deepseek-v3.1
  • qwen/qwen3-coder-480b-a35b-instruct
  • moonshotai/kimi-k2-0905
  • openai/gpt-oss-120b
  • google/gemma-3-12b-it

步驟 2:安裝 Codex CLI

需要 Node.js 18 或更高版本

node -v

透過 npm 安裝(推薦)

npm install -g @openai/codex

透過 Homebrew 安裝(macOS)

brew install codex

驗證安裝

codex --version

透過 Novita AI API 配置 GLM 4.5

建立 Codex 配置文件並將 GLM 4.5 設為預設模型:

  • macOS/Linux: ~/.codex/config.toml
  • Windows: %USERPROFILE%\.codex\config.toml

基本配置模板

model = "zai-org/glm-4.5"
model_provider = "novitaai"

[model_providers.novitaai]
name = "Novita AI"
base_url = "https://api.novita.ai/openai"
http_headers = {"Authorization" = "Bearer YOUR_NOVITA_API_KEY"}
wire_api = "chat"

步驟 3:開始使用

啟動 Codex CLI

codex

基本使用範例

程式碼生成

> Create a Python class for handling REST API responses with error handling

專案分析

> Review this codebase and suggest improvements for performance

錯誤修復

> Fix the authentication error in the login function

測試

> Generate comprehensive unit tests for the user service module

在現有專案中使用

啟動 Codex CLI 前,請先導航到你的專案目錄:

cd /path/to/your/project
codex

Codex CLI 會自動理解你的專案結構、讀取現有檔案,並在整個會話中維護關於程式碼庫的上下文。

故障排除

錯誤 / 現象 可能原因 解決方法
401 未授權 API 金鑰無效或已過期;請求頭格式錯誤 在 Novita AI 重新生成金鑰,並在 config.toml 中更新為正確的 Authorization = "Bearer …" 格式
404 模型未找到 模型名稱錯誤 使用精確字串:zai-org/glm-4.5
緩慢 / 超時 網路延遲、代理設定或超時時間過短 重試較短的提示詞,檢查 VPN/代理設定,提高超時標誌參數
模型無法切換 配置文件路徑錯誤或存在拼寫錯誤 確認配置文件路徑為 ~/.codex/config.toml(Linux/macOS)或 %USERPROFILE%\.codex\config.toml(Windows);重啟 Shell
CLI 凍結 多行提示詞未正確結束 在 bash/zsh 中使用 here-doc(<< 'EOF' ... EOF);在 PowerShell 中使用 here-string
Windows 路徑錯誤 配置文件誤放置在 System32 目錄 將文件移動到 %USERPROFILE%\.codex\config.toml
請求頻率限制 / 載荷錯誤 併發請求過多或輸入內容過大 新增帶退避機制的重試邏輯,修剪上下文,拆分過長的文件

總結

GLM 4.5 具備先進的編程與代理能力,而 Codex 提供了一種輕量的方式,讓你可以直接在終端機中使用這些能力。兩者結合創造的工作流程快速、靈活,非常適合快速原型開發與企業級環境。

對開發者而言,這種組合意味著更少的障礙:GLM 4.5 提供強大的推理與編程能力,搭配 Codex 無需離開 CLI 即可編排任務的特性,大幅提升開發效率。

常見問題

什麼是 GLM 4.5?

GLM 4.5 是 Z.ai 的旗艦大型語言模型,專為編程、推理與代理任務優化。

GLM 4.5 能直接在 Codex 中使用嗎?

可以。Codex 透過 API 配置支援 GLM 4.5 整合。

如何獲取 GLM 4.5 的使用權限?

從 Novita AI 平台生成 API 金鑰,並將其新增到你的 Codex 配置文件中即可。

Novita AI 是一個 AI 雲端平台,為開發者提供簡單的 API 介面,方便部署 AI 模型,同時也提供平價且可靠的 GPU 雲端服務,用於構建與擴展 AI 應用。